2024 NAB Marconi Radio Award Winners Announced


Marconi Awards
Marconi Awards

The National Association of Broadcasters (NAB) presented the 2024 NAB Marconi Radio Awards, a celebration held at the Javits Center during NAB Show New York. The ceremony was hosted by radio and television personality Bobby Bones featuring DJ Scratch as the house DJ for the night. KYGO-FM Denver was named the Legendary Station of the Year and Bennett Zier of Audacy, Virginia was named Legendary Radio Manager of the Year.

Established in 1989 and named after inventor and Nobel Prize winner Guglielmo Marconi, the NAB Marconi Radio Awards are given to radio stations and outstanding air personalities to recognize excellence in radio.

Legendary Station of the Year
KYGO-FM Denver, CO

Legendary Radio Manager of the Year
Bennett Zier, Audacy, VA

Network/Syndicated Personality of the Year
Erica Campbell, Reach Media/Urban One, Dallas, TX

Major Market Personality of the Year
Rachel Ryan, KSCS-FM, Dallas, TX

Large Market Personality of the Year
Dan Mandis, WWTN-FM, Nashville, TN

Medium Market Personality of the Year
Andy Beckman & Kat Walburn, WAJI-FM, Fort Wayne, IN

Small Market Personality of the Year
Kat Mykals, WGBF-FM, Evansville, IN

Major Market Station of the Year
KTCK-AM Dallas, TX

Large Market Station of the Year
WWRM-FM Tampa, FL

Medium Market Station of the Year
WNRP-AM Pensacola, FL

Small Market Station of the Year
KQRQ-FM Rapid City, SD

Best Radio Podcast of the Year
"El Bueno, La Mala y El Feo," Univision Radio, Los Angeles, CA

AC Station of the Year
WTVR-FM Richmond, VA

CHR Station of the Year
WBLI-FM Long Island, NY

Classic Hits Station of the Year
WGRR-FM Cincinnati, OH

College Radio Station of the Year
WPSC-FM, William Paterson University, Wayne, NJ

Country Station of the Year
WXTU-FM, Philadelphia, PA

News/Talk Station of the Year
KDKA-AM, Pittsburgh, PA

Religious Station of the Year
WNNL-FM, Raleigh, NC

Rock Station of the Year
KQMT-FM, Denver, CO

Spanish Language Station of the Year
WLZL-FM, Washington, DC

Sports Station of the Year
KKFN-FM, Denver, CO

Urban Station of the Year
WBTJ-FM, Richmond, VA

Marconi finalists were selected by a committee of broadcasters, and the winners were voted on by the NAB Marconi Radio Awards Selection Academy.
